When you purchase a new tent for camping, take it home and completely set the tent up before going on a camping trip. That way, you won’t be missing any pieces, and you’ll be able to set it up correctly the first time. That can also cut down on the frustration some feel when setting a tent up for the first time.

Bring along a sleeping bags appropriate for the season. You are going to be really hot and uncomfortable camping in a sleeping bag is rated for sub-zero temperatures. On the flip side, bringing a light-weight bag in the middle of winter could cause you to wake up freezing. You might even experience hypothermia.

While it may be that there’s enough wood around to keep a fire going for a long time, it could quite possibly be wet wood that doesn’t really want to burn. Bring along some wood and store it in an area that is not moist when you camp.

Purchase camping pillows that are made specifically for camping. Standard pillows can become hot and sticky in humid weather. They also take moisture out of the air and can mildew quickly. Pillows made specifically for camping offer a protective layer that prevents moisture absorption.

When you are camping, be sure you choose the right sleeping bag for the site conditions. If the weather is warm, you want a lightweight bag. If frigid temperatures will be present, choose a sub-zero rated bag. You must have a bag that surrounds the body closely so that body heat can be retained.

People will often forget to build their shelter before sunset. It is really hard to set up a tent in the dark. You will need to build a fire or have a sufficient number of flashlights. It is so much easier to erect your tent and organize your camping area before sunset.

Make sure that all food safety whenever you go camping. Make sure to pack your foods in airtight bags and waterproof containers. Keep food inside insulated coolers. Make sure to keep your raw or cooked food separate. Make sure your hands are clean by washing them or using hand sanitizer. Cook foods to proper temperatures and chill foods that need to be cold chilled quickly.

A first aid kid is essential to have in your camping gear. You need to be able to deal with any accidents that may occur while away. You need to put essentials in your kit such as splints, bandages, snake bite remedies and gauze for dressing wounds.
